    KIB launches new Western Union Cash Pickup Service through its Mobile App

    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est WhatsApp

    Kuwait, 17 November 2025: Kuwait International Bank (KIB) announced the launch of its new Western Union Cash Pickup service through the KIB Mobile App. The new service enables customers in Kuwait to send international money transfers digitally with just a few taps, while beneficiaries abroad can conveniently collect the funds in cash from Western Union agent locations across more than 200 countries and territories.     Maqamess highlighted that the service is effective immediately, and is available 24/7, giving KIB customers around-the-clock access to international remittances through a secure digital channel. He added: “Through this feature, beneficiaries around the world can receive cash quickly and securely from any nearby Western Union agent, offering a practical solution for individuals living in markets where digital or bank transfers may be less accessible.”

    The development and rollout of the Western Union Cash Pickup service were led by KIB’s Digital Innovation & Data Intelligence Department, in cooperation with the Retail Banking Department, ensuring a seamless and compliant transfer process that adheres to global security protocols and regulatory standards. This feature is part of a broader roadmap to enhance cross-border payment services, while giving customers full control through a single, powerful digital platform.
